The Sharp Cup Team won its Semi-Final 4 – 1 against The Grange (Gold) at the The Grange on Sunday.  The course was in exceptional condition and the weather was great all day.

At No. 4 Jack Ramage was the first to complete his match, although Jack played some solid golf unfortunately he lost 4/3.

At No. 5 Jade Kinita was the second to complete her match, she played some exceptional golf and controlled her match throughout the day recording a 2/1 win.  Well done Jade on your first Sharp Cup win!

At No. 3 Aaron Buchanan was the third to complete his match, Aaron displayed his normal never say die attitude on the golf course recording a 2/1 win.  Well done lad!

At No. 1 Harry Edwards played great golf and displayed excellent maturity under pressure to win 3/2.

At No.  2 Kane Hyams holed out from off the green on the 17th hole to win his match 2/1 before he was aware that Glenelg had already won the 3 matches required to progress to the Final.  Yes Kane!

A big thank you to the caddies and spectators who attended the Semi-Final, your efforts are very much appreciated by the team.

On Sunday the team will be playing against Kooyonga at Flagstaff Hill to determine the winner of the Sharp Cup.  Having won the Sharp Cup in 2016 & 2017 the team are incredibly excited to have the opportunity retain it at The Bay for the third year in a row.
